Manassas Park, Prince William County, Virginia Property Taxes
Median Manassas Park, VA effective property tax rate: 1.04%, slightly higher than the national median of 1.02%, but lower than the Virginia state median of 0.89%.
Median Manassas Park, VA home value: $603,050
Median annual Manassas Park, VA tax bill: $6,310, $3,910 higher than the national median property tax bill of $2,400.

Property Tax Rates Across Manassas Park, Prince William County, Virginia
Local government entities determine tax rates, which can differ significantly within a state. Each year, counties estimate their required budget to maintain services and divide it by the total value of all taxable property within their jurisdiction. This calculation results in the property tax rate. While votes and laws play a role in setting tax rates and budgets, this is the annual process in a nutshell.

Property Tax Assessment Values Across Manassas Park, Prince William County, Virginia
When examining property taxes in Manassas Park, VA, understanding the distinction between "market value" and "assessed value" is crucial. The market value is what a willing buyer would pay to a willing seller in an open and competitive market, often influenced by location, property condition, and economic market trends. The Prince William County appraisal district estimates the market value for tax purposes. The assessed value is the market value minus any applicable exemptions or limits determined by local laws and offerings. The tax assessed value is the figure used to calculate your property taxes or the amount multiplied by your tax rate to get your tax bill.
Assessment notices in Prince William County are sent in the spring each year and typically reach your mailbox by the middle of the season. Each property owner receives an assessment notice that contains both the market value and assessed value, along with an estimate of your property tax bill.
